  • Abstract
    An active power filter (APF) based on a new method of determining the current reference is presented in this paper. In the proposed method of getting the current reference, two aspects are covered, i.e., the phase and the amplitude of the reference. For the former, a sliding Fourier analysis approach is employed, where the Fourier analysis is carried out in a sliding coordinate system, eliminating the accumulated error caused by the difference between the internally generated time reference and the line cycle when discretizing the Fourier algorithm. And the latter is determined from the viewpoint of energy balance. The proposed method features in its software synchronization, making it unnecessary for an extra synchronization circuit to the grid. The proposed active power filter works well under various load conditions, especially in the case of a distorted or unbalanced supply. Experimental results obtained from the prototype confirm the feasibility of the proposed method.
